summ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orThierry Bastian <thierry.bastian@nokia.com>2009-06-04 08:45:17 (GMT)
committerThierry Bastian <thierry.bastian@nokia.com>2009-06-04 08:46:41 (GMT)
commitc116ffaa7abb26373475921db7410503a79b4207 (patch)
treebaf44a336198c98e8ce5b705e5daff02b9e7b67b
parent397c3bb494e220af5ef1cf6e47cfdfc84b61540b (diff)
downloadQt-c116ffaa7abb26373475921db7410503a79b4207.zip
Qt-c116ffaa7abb26373475921db7410503a79b4207.tar.gz
Qt-c116ffaa7abb26373475921db7410503a79b4207.tar.bz2
Fixed the frame that would sometimes not be painted around widgets in
a QStatusBar Task-number: 253717 Reviewed-by: ogoffart
-rw-r--r--src/gui/widgets/qstatusbar.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/gui/widgets/qstatusbar.cpp b/src/gui/widgets/qstatusbar.cpp
index 3829bcb..a248346 100644
--- a/src/gui/widgets/qstatusbar.cpp
+++ b/src/gui/widgets/qstatusbar.cpp
@@ -728,7 +728,7 @@ void QStatusBar::paintEvent(QPaintEvent *event)
QStatusBarPrivate::SBItem* item = d->items.at(i);
if (item && item->w->isVisible() && (!haveMessage || item->p)) {
QRect ir = item->w->geometry().adjusted(-2, -1, 2, 1);
- if (event->rect().contains(ir)) {
+ if (event->rect().intersects(ir)) {
QStyleOption opt(0);
opt.rect = ir;
opt.palette = palette();